Our Mission:

The Office of Public Insurance Counsel (OPIC) represents the interests of Texas consumers in insurance matters. OPIC empowers and educates consumers and works on their behalf to create and maintain a balanced marketplace.

What We Do

The Texas Legislature established OPIC as an independent agency in 1991. OPIC represents the interests of Texas consumers in insurance matters.

Regulatory

OPIC reviews and analyzes insurance rates, rules, and policy forms. As a result of these reviews, OPIC may make comments, raise concerns, or file formal objections. The agency may also intervene as a party in rate hearings before the Commissioner of Insurance and the State Office of Administrative Hearings.

Legislative

OPIC recommends legislation to the Texas Legislature that benefits insurance consumers. OPIC also provides resource testimony and information on insurance issues.

Consumer Education and Outreach

One of OPIC’s most important duties is consumer education and outreach. The agency annually develops a Health Maintenance Organization (HMO) report card so consumers can evaluate HMOs’ quality of care and consumer satisfaction. OPIC produces consumer bills of rights to help Texans understand their rights under the law. Staff also assists consumers over the phone and by email.

OPIC creates informational postcards, brochures, and other materials for consumers. OPIC also educates consumers through its website and social media applications. The Policy Comparison Tool on the website helps consumers compare policies and coverage when shopping for insurance. Agents can send feedback about issues in the marketplace through the website’s Agent Portal.
